History Of Spanish Missions. The spanish missions have survived in an urban and industrialized world. Historically, culturally, and architecturally, the early spanish missions left their mark on the american west. The spanish mission was a frontier institution that sought to incorporate indigenous people into the spanish colonial empire, its catholic religion, and certain aspects of its hispanic. The mission of the alamo (san antonio de valero in. Spain was responsible for the missions, which scholars believe were attempts to colonize the pacific coast of north america. Known today as the alamo, this spanish mission complex was the first of the san antonio missions founded to convert the local american indians to christianity. The spanish missions, like forts and towns, were frontier institutions that pioneered european colonial claims and sovereignty in north america.
